The Price of Proficiency: Understanding the Cost Factors of Hiring a Skilled React JS Developer
Introduction
In today's tech-driven world, React JS has emerged as a powerhouse in web development, empowering businesses to create dynamic and interactive user interfaces. Hiring a skilled React JS developer is a crucial investment for any project, but understanding the cost factors involved is equally important. In this blog, we delve into the intricacies of hiring a proficient React JS developer and unravel the various cost elements associated with this critical decision and hire react js developer.
The Demand-Driven Economy
The global demand for React JS developers has surged in recent years, driven by the framework's popularity and versatility. The laws of supply and demand come into play, affecting the cost of hiring. As more companies seek to harness the power of React JS, the pool of available experienced developers may not meet the burgeoning demand, leading to increased costs for their services.
Skillset and Experience
Proficiency in React JS is a valuable skillset that comes with experience. Developers with a deep understanding of the framework, coupled with hands-on experience in creating complex applications, often command higher compensation. Their ability to design efficient and scalable solutions contributes significantly to the success of your project, making their expertise a valuable asset.
Project Complexity
The complexity of your project plays a pivotal role in determining the cost of hiring a skilled React JS developer. Basic websites or applications may require a developer with a solid foundation in React JS, while intricate projects necessitate a developer who can handle complex state management, integration with various APIs, and optimized UI/UX designs. The more intricate the project, the higher the level of expertise required, consequently affecting the cost.
Geographical Location
The geographic location of the React JS developer also influences the cost. Developers from regions with a higher cost of living and greater demand for tech talent might charge more for their services. Offshoring or outsourcing to countries with a lower cost of living can provide cost savings without compromising on quality. However, communication and time zone differences should be considered when pursuing this option.
Freelancer vs. Agency vs. In-House
Another consideration is the type of arrangement you choose for hiring a React JS developer. Freelancers often offer flexibility and cost savings, but may lack the resources for large-scale projects. Agencies provide a team of experts but may come with a higher price tag. Hiring an in-house developer offers control and consistency but involves expenses like salaries, benefits, and overhead costs.
Market Research
Conducting thorough market research is essential to understanding the prevailing rates for hiring React JS developers. Networking, attending tech conferences, and leveraging online platforms can help you gauge the average compensation for developers with varying levels of expertise. This information will empower you to negotiate effectively and make informed decisions.
Conclusion
Hiring a skilled React JS developer is an investment in the success of your web development project. While the cost factors may vary based on demand, skillset, project complexity, location, and hiring model, understanding these elements will enable you to make a well-informed decision. Balancing the cost of hiring with the value of expertise is key to achieving a high-quality, functional, and user-friendly web application that aligns with your business goals.